技术文摘
基于鸿蒙自定义属性打造随心所欲的自定义标题组件
2024-12-31 06:43:32 小编
基于鸿蒙自定义属性打造随心所欲的自定义标题组件
在当今的数字化时代,用户对于应用界面的个性化和灵活性有着越来越高的要求。鸿蒙操作系统为开发者提供了强大的自定义属性功能,使得打造随心所欲的自定义标题组件成为可能。
自定义属性为开发者赋予了极大的灵活性。通过在鸿蒙中定义特定的属性,我们能够精确控制标题组件的各种特征,如字体大小、颜色、对齐方式等。这意味着我们可以根据不同的应用场景和用户需求,轻松创建出独特且符合整体设计风格的标题。
例如,在一个阅读类应用中,我们可以将标题的字体设置得较大且清晰,颜色选择柔和的色调,以提供舒适的阅读体验。而在一个游戏应用中,标题可能需要更加醒目和富有动感,通过使用鲜艳的颜色和独特的字体样式来吸引玩家的注意力。
利用鸿蒙的自定义属性,还能够实现标题组件的动态效果。比如,根据不同的用户操作或应用状态,实时改变标题的显示效果。当用户点击某个按钮时,标题可以进行闪烁、缩放或颜色变换,从而提供直观的反馈和增强用户的交互感。
自定义属性还支持响应式设计。这意味着标题组件能够自适应不同的屏幕尺寸和分辨率,确保在各种设备上都能呈现出最佳的视觉效果。无论是在手机、平板还是大屏幕设备上,用户都能获得一致且优质的体验。
在实现自定义标题组件的过程中,需要开发者对鸿蒙的开发框架和相关技术有深入的理解。注重用户体验和设计原则也是至关重要的。要确保自定义的标题组件不仅在外观上吸引人,而且在功能和易用性方面也能够满足用户的期望。
基于鸿蒙的自定义属性,开发者能够充分发挥创意和想象力,打造出满足各种需求和风格的自定义标题组件。这将为应用带来更高的品质和竞争力,为用户带来更加个性化和出色的使用体验。
- 正则表达式的详细用法
- Ajax 函数的封装方法
- Laravel 中 Ajax CURD、搜索及登录判断功能的实现
- PHP 操作 Redis 数据库基础示例:安装、连接、设置、查询与断开
- 基于 Ajax 和 PHP 的商品价格计算实现
- Ajax 达成省市县三级联动
- 利用 AJAX 进行注册用户名验证
- 正则表达式 findall 函数轻松详解
- Ajax 局部刷新的实现方法示例
- 基于 Promise 和参数解构的 Ajax 请求封装方法
- 正则表达式非贪婪匹配轻松入门详解
- 正则表达式中边界 \\b 和 \\B 的深度解析
- AJAX 检测用户名存在与否的方法
- PHP 本地采集图片下载方法详解(可忽略 ssl 认证)
- Ajax 打造页面无刷新留言体验